Unruly juveniles are those who
Zigmanuir [339]

Answer:

D) are under eighteen years of age and who commit acts that would not be considered crimes if they were committed by adults.

Explanation:

In the eyes of the law, a juvenile or a minor is any person under the legal adult age. This age varies from state to state, but in most states, the legal age of the majority is 18. CREDIT: Criminal.findlaw

A juvenile is said to be "unruly" when he or she will not follow the rules of home, school, or community and as a result, is subjected to penalties imposed by the Court. CREDIT: Co.hancock.oh.us
